What happens to protein in cooked meat?

When you cook meat, the temperature goes up. As the temperature reaches 40C/105F, the proteins begin to denature. Denaturing means that the proteins unravel and deform themselves, and the water is pushed out of the muscle fibers.

Do you lose protein when cooking?

Studies of the effects of cooking and other methods of processing report no significant alterations in the protein value of meat. However, cooking at too high a temperature for long periods of time can slightly decrease the biological value of meat proteins.

What happens when you over cook meat?

Raw meat is essentially a bundle of protein, fat, and liquid. When you overcook meat, you’re rendering out the fat and liquid, so all you’re really left with are the toughened muscle fibers.

Does cooking meat denature protein?

During cooking of meat, the thermal denaturation of different muscle proteins such as myosin, sarcoplasmic protein, collagen, and actin occurs at different temperatures. … However, heat treatment during cooking induces a non-uniform distribution of protein denaturation in macro meat systems.

Does frying an egg destroy the protein?

Does Frying an Egg Retain Its Protein? A fried egg contains the same amount of protein as an egg cooked scrambled, boiled, done over-easy or eaten raw stirred into in a glass of tomato juice. But a fried egg’s protein will be more easily digested and absorbed than a raw egg’s.
